Transaction 34c2e33da11c84123a84d6430e35329fc5c32fadf607c5151c51cb02b6537d9e

block
a10a66ee0db8f5dd32f43edaf09e9007a99f15d0a5f6928ad6af049c33d98b89

1 Input

25 Outputs